Cleveland, Adare William
In BAGHDAD, IRAQ on February 19, 2007, the ARMY lost SPC Cleveland, Adare William of ANCHORAGE, AK, 19, serving with TROOP B, 1ST SQUADRON, 89TH CAVALRY, FORT DRUM, NY. Cause: HOSTILE.

Operation Iraqi Freedom began March 19, 2003 with the US-led invasion. The stated justification ? weapons of mass destruction ? was never found. Seven years of occupation, insurgency, and sectarian war followed, killing 4,418 Americans and an estimated 200,000 Iraqi civilians.
